CABS

Collaboration across Boundaries: Culture, Distance, & Technology is an international and interdisciplinary conference focused on exploring the nature and ways to facilitate intercultural collaboration. CABS 2014 is the 5th international conference in the series formerly held as International Conference on Intercultural Collaboration (ICIC).

CABS aims to be a multidisciplinary forum that integrates the socio-cultural and technical perspectives, with the objective of exchanging the latest results of studying and supporting intercultural collaboration.
